Paul Kemp

General Counsel at HTC Global Services

Paul manages all legal issues of the corporation including contract negotiations, corporate acquisitions, intellectual property matters, and the statutory and regulatory requirements that govern the company’s business practices, including the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act (HIPAA) and Stark, which governs the practice of physician referrals to medical facilities.

Additionally, Paul serves as the company’s internal compliance officer ensuring that HTC Global Services conducts business not only in compliance with the applicable law but also with the highest ethical standards.

Paul negotiated the partnership agreement between Detroit Medical Center (DMC) and Oakwood Healthcare System (OHS) that establishes ownership of HTC Global Services between its hospital partners and Compuware Corp. He later joined the company in 2004, and since then negotiated more than 100 contracts with hospitals for HTC Global Services products and services. Most recently, Paul was instrumental in the acquisition of a competitor as well as the purchase of the company’s newest data center.

Paul is a graduate of the University of Michigan-Dearborn and the University of Michigan Law School. He is a member of the Michigan Bar, the American Bar Association, and the Association of Corporate Counsel. Previously he was also associated with the law firms Clark Hill PLC and Pepper Hamilton LLP.
